What to know about ZIP 88063

ZIP code 88063 covers Sunland Park, NM in Doña Ana County with a population of about 11,282.

At a glance, the area shows median age of 30.9 versus a U.S. median of about 38.9.

It sits in telephone area code 575; U.S. House district NM-2; the EL PASO (LAS CRUCES) media market.

Income and economy in Sunland Park, NM

Median household income in ZIP 88063 is about $35,947 — about 52% below the U.S. median ($75,149).

On socioeconomic markers, US5 shows a poverty rate of 29.3%; unemployment rate near 3.2%; 13.1% of adults with a bachelor’s degree or higher (about 20.7 points below the national share (33.7%)).

Labor and commute patterns include leading industry context around Healthcare, Retail trade, and Manufacturing; about 5.2% of workers reporting work-from-home (about 10.0 points below the U.S. share (15.2%)); a mean commute of about 180.0 minutes (U.S. average near 26.8).

Housing and affordability in ZIP 88063

Median home value is about $121,900 — about 65% below the U.S. median home value ($348,079).

Housing tenure and rents show median gross rent around $537 (about 54% below the U.S. median rent ($1,163)), and owner-occupancy near 73.0% (about 7.5 points above the national owner-occupancy rate (65.4%)).

To comfortably buy a median-priced home in ZIP 88063 in Sunland Park, NM, a household would need roughly $34,000 in annual income under a 20% down, 30-year loan at 6.8% (illustrative), keeping housing costs near 28% of income. Estimated monthly PITI is about $783. That is roughly in line with the local median household income ($35,947). Climate risk and migration signals

FEMA’s National Risk Index rates natural-hazard risk for Sunland Park city, NM as Relatively High (composite score 96.1), which is among the highest nationally. The strongest component scores on US5 are flood (98.4) and wildfire (86.6). These scores are county-linked NRI values published for planning context — all ZIP codes in the same county share the same composite score on US5. Useful when comparing insurance and disaster exposure across areas, not a substitute for a parcel-level flood or fire determination.

Climate normals for Sunland Park city, NM show little to no average snow and around 10.1 inches of annual precipitation.

IRS migration statistics show a net inflow of about 356 for ZIP 88063 (Sunland Park city, NM) on US5’s published series — a signal of people/tax filers moving in relative to those leaving. Inflows often track job growth, housing demand, or lifestyle migration; treat the figure as a directional indicator rather than a precise headcount.
